Power of Attraction
Book one in the Blackstone
Haven series.
A man will come to you
in the darkest moon. The trees will shade and protect your union of
the soul. Before the final step to merge your body is taken, a choice
must be made.
Peyton Blackstone, a
natural born witch, knew from the prophecy that accompanied her birth
that a man would come to her. Yet, when the man who is set to be her’s
arrives, Peyton isn’t ready for him or the ramifications his coming
will cause. This man who deals with reality has a few secrets of his
own--secrets that could very well destroy them both.
Wesley McCarty
believes the woman he meets under the moonlight is not real. Suffering
from unexplained blackouts, he believes he is losing his mind. When he
sees her again, he realizes not only is his fantasy woman real, but
she is within his reach. He must have her, no matter the cost.
Nothing will stop him. Not his blackouts, or any legacies or
prophecies. He will have this woman who sets his blood on fire and
completes his soul.
Legacies, destiny, and
prophecy can not withstand this power of attraction.
Power of
Instinct
Book Two
in the Blackstone Haven series.
A familiar man of two
souls will walk beside you. He will protect you with his animal soul.
His human spirit will shelter you when you most need. Before the final
step to merge your body and soul is taken, a choice must be made.
Sinai Blackstone never expected the prophecy she had to fulfill would
create such complications. Her reasons for going against the prophecy
are sound. But when Ian finds out, it isn’t just the prophecy that is
affected. Sinai isn’t prepared to deal with all that being with Ian
entails. There is so much more than fulfilling some family legend at
stake. Her heart, soul, and very life are on the line.
Ian McIntyre knows that Sinai believes she did what’s for the best.
Yet, she has no clue their joining is beyond even what she could know.
It isn’t about choice. It’s just meant to be. He would face legends
for her. Give his life if needed. There was no choice for him. He
would be with Sinai no matter the cost. Nothing will stand in his
way--not Sinai and her stubborn pride, not death that is stalking her,
nor anything on this earth or any plane. Sinai is his other half, the
match for his soul, blood, and body.
When it becomes primal, there is no other way to handle legacies,
destiny, and prophecy except… to go with your Power of Instinct. |
